All-or-none suppression of glucose sham feeding by an intragastric mixed meal in rats.
1991
Rats were permitted to sham feed a 1 M glucose solution after varying delays (0-40 min) following the intragastric (IG) infusion of a large, nutritionally adequate meal. (a) The metal affected sham feeding in an all-or-none way. After such a meal, sham feeding was either suppressed almost entirely, or it was not suppressed at all as compared with a no-meal control condition. (b) When it occurred, the suppression was short-lived: As little asa 20-min delay after the meal could suffice to change its suppressant effect from «all» to «none»
